Documentation is where clinical care and revenue meet: the same note that records the visit also justifies the code and the level of service billed, so a complete, real-time note protects both patient care quality and the revenue that depends on it.
The time physicians spend charting is time not spent with patients, and the after-hours documentation known as "pajama time" is a leading driver of burnout and turnover. Beyond the human cost, rushed or incomplete notes create real financial risk: documentation that doesn't fully support the level of service leads to down-coding, denials, and audit exposure. Scribing addresses the root cause by capturing the encounter accurately as it happens.
Complete, accurate documentation is the foundation of correct coding and billing. When notes fully capture the encounter, coders can assign the correct codes and level of service with confidence, and claims are far less likely to be denied for insufficient documentation.
